java 数组迭代器

//我们先往链表中装东西
ArrayList a = new ArrayList();
a.add("a");
a.add("b");
(数据结构中应该算是双向链表吧(双向还是单向不太清楚))
//从链表中取东西,用到了迭代器

Iterator iter = a.iterator() ; //iter迭代器对象,可以用它来数了
while(iter.hasNext()){
String m = (String)iter.next();
System.out.println(m);
}
首先需要判断有没有接下来的东西:iter.hasNext()
就是拿东西:iter.next();
好比下楼,从顶楼往下,到1楼了没-1楼所以就停止了
或到了你需要的楼层就停下
可以看看数据结构
补充下
(数组遍历和集合遍历是不同的,集合是容器,数组是模具,你也可以将集合用一个数组储存,再用数组遍历,但是这样不如迭代器来的更方便)
falloutboy最新的歌 卞允智妈妈微博 wan微型端口出现叹号 dele b2口语 培贤好还是卓越好 蓝天oc超频软件 final value fee 电视剧有凸点 纲手邪恶漫画 上海动物园开放时间 认真的的英文 had the governments 小米路由器上传日志 qq业务站在哪里 沉醉喜妞全文阅读 timeval linux 王嘉尔上和下视频 哥哥最邪恶的漫画 windows10快速关机 ionic toast 换行 公司质押股票利率 玛泽的故事英文文本 国服第五骚知乎 如何开矿泉水厂 Never Far Away铃声 cc2530 power saving c map排序输出 任性英文单词 sex make in a car 关注自动回复语

Copyright 满意通 Some Rights Reserved

如反馈或投诉等情况联系:une35498#163.com